Transaction e5cd88c0604937aabdb4d79a9ff059b2346ee5b66b3281d45836ce58c5c0a625

2 Input
2 Outputs
  • e5cd88c0604937aabdb4d79a9ff059b2346ee5b66b3281d45836ce58c5c0a625:0
  • value  2257507011
    address  38f8RHFQ8v6avZqCmaYTga5bTYiuhoM6fh
  • e5cd88c0604937aabdb4d79a9ff059b2346ee5b66b3281d45836ce58c5c0a625:1
  • value  184103430
    address  1KiYYnvRw7ZYLypJExoNqpK6VMkpK72mLb